Riesch leads Vonn overall, Maze wins

MARIA Riesch regained the lead in a tense chase for the overall World Cup title in Switzerland yesterday, finishing fourth in a slalom race won by Tina Maze of Slovenia.

Riesch earned 50 points and now has a three-point lead over Lindsey Vonn of the United States. Vonn, the three-time defending champion, had led her German rival by 27 but finished 13th in the final slalom of the season to score 20 points. The title will be decided in a giant slalom race today worth 100 points to the winner.
